Menlift Although the lifts are often come by and used by man in daily life, in this study they are not only taken as vertical transportation machines, but also studied as important machines including very important factors. Therefore there are some important criterions that should be considered when someone is choosing a lift for a bulding or industrial astate. As the purpose of the vertical transportation is to transport, this transportation should be within the shortest time and in the safest way, to be able to fulfill the purpose the desing and the plan parameters must be chosen carefully and be obeyed. As lift trip starts with the press of a button if finishes by passengers stepping out of the lift cabin. To be able to make the journey in the shortest time and the safest way, it is necessary to choose the lift design parameters in the most convenient way and the kind of points that should be paid attention to is explained. The aim is to serve man at the maximum level by calculating lift traffic according to these parameters. Considering the lift assembly is done any once or to replace is very costly; it is necessary to be careful with some lift parameters when choosing them first. Then calculation of lift traffic should be done beforehand to provide a comfortable service. Other wise when there is a traffic jam the lift will became a torturing machine instead of a service machine, or if there is a very seldom usage of the lift there will be an unnecessary financial cost for the lift owner and the national economy. Considering these aspects, so far lifts have been produced disregarding all these parameters which are considered during lift designs. From now on parameters should be chosen according to service conditions and according to the traffic calculation results which were done in the light of these parameters and the lifts should be presented for service in the most convenient conditions. In this study the importance of this subject is emphasized.
